Aims & Scope
The Journal publishes work related to evidence-based health care risk management, enterprise risk management which includes: clinical risk management, patient safety, quality improvement, risk financing, claims and litigation, health care preparedness, risk management tools and techniques, the health care risk management workforce, and other timely risk management issues.
